In this article we'll go over the pros and cons of being a residential property manager, but initially what does a residential or commercial property supervisor also do? A residential or commercial property supervisor is accountable for supervising the everyday procedures of a rental home in support of the owner. However, the particular tasks of a residential or commercial property manager might differ relying on the sort of property being managed and the terms of the administration contract.


Gathering rental fee. Keeping the home. Collaborating repair services. Reacting to tenant grievances and conflicts. Handling finances. Guaranteeing conformity with pertinent regulations and guidelines. Carrying out routine residential property inspections. Taking care of expulsions if necessary. Being a residential or commercial property manager is not an easy task. It needs juggling numerous tasks and obligations and calls for a mix of social, technological, monetary, and even lawful abilities.


They also require to be able to manage emergencies such as water leakages, fires, or various other crashes. The home manager likewise needs to remain up-to-date on neighborhood and state policies connected to rental buildings, reasonable housing laws, and expulsion processes, as breaching these guidelines can lead to legal trouble and a lot more tension.

Historically, the problem of unreasonable requests and complaints has been an obstacle for home supervisors. In the past, proprietors were commonly seen as being less competent to occupant needs, resulting in conflicts and conflicts. This assumption has changed over the last few years, as lots of residential property management companies have actually welcomed client service and renter contentment as core worths.


There are numerous reasons occupants may make unreasonable requests or grievances. In some cases, renters might have impractical assumptions regarding what a residential or commercial property administration firm can do or what is within their control. Various other times, occupants may be frustrated with various other elements of their lives and get their anger on building supervisors.
